Types of server racks
- Open frame server racks. This option is popular due to its simplicity and accessibility. They do not have sides or doors, allowing quick access to equipment from all sides. These racks are suitable for areas where safety is not an issue but ventilation is critical.
- Closed server racks.These racks offer heightened security through the inclusion of sides, doors, and lockable panels, safeguarding against physical tampering as well as dust and debris intrusion.
- Wall-mounted server racks. These compact solutions are designed to be attached directly to walls. They are ideal for small spaces or spaces with limited space. Despite their compact size, they can accommodate the necessary network equipment.
- Racks for cabinets. Cabinet racks bear resemblance to enclosed racks, yet they boast enhanced durability and frequently offer supplementary features such as cable management systems, ventilation choices, and integrated power distribution units (PDUs). These racks are predominantly deployed in enterprise-level data centers where top-tier reliability and scalability are paramount.
Types of network racks
Network racks, alternatively referred to as network cabinets or enclosures, are tailored server racks engineered specifically for networking apparatus. They are available in diverse configurations to house switches, routers, patch panels, and other networking devices. Typical variants of network racks encompass:
Standard network racks. These racks typically feature 19-inch mounting rails and are compatible with standard networking equipment.
Mini network racks. These are compact versions of standard racks, ideal for small offices or areas with limited space.
Wall-mounted network racks. Like wall-mounted server racks, they are designed specifically for networking equipment and can be mounted directly on walls.
Types of racks in data centers
In a data center setting, various types of racks coexist to accommodate a range of equipment and infrastructure needs. Aside from standard server and network racks, there are other specialized categories:
- Cooling racks: These racks incorporate dedicated cooling mechanisms such as fans or liquid cooling systems to uphold optimal operational temperatures for sensitive equipment.
- Power distribution racks: These racks accommodate power distribution units and other power management tools to ensure dependable power allocation to all devices within the data center.
- Cable routing racks: Designed for structured organization and secure management of network cables, these racks minimize clutter and mitigate the risk of cable damage or disconnection.
- Blade server racks: Specifically crafted to house blade servers, which are compact yet high-performance computing devices known for their scalability and efficiency.
Components
Creating an effective network rack involves careful selection and arrangement of various components for optimal performance and organization. Key network rack components include:
Switches that can be used to manage network traffic by redirecting data packets between devices on the network.
Routers. By connecting multiple networks, you can simplify the transfer of data between them.
Patch panels. They provide a centralized point for connecting and managing network cables.
Power distribution units (PDUs). These units distribute power to network equipment within the rack.
Accessories for cable routing. Includes cable trays, cable organizers and cable ties to organize and protect network cables, minimize clutter and improve airflow.
